The first step toward a healthier, happier you starts here—at the Marshall Area YMCA. But let’s be real: walking into a new place, especially a busy fitness center, can feel intimidating. The sounds, the energy, the people who seem to know exactly what they’re doing—it’s easy to feel out of place. But guess what? You belong here. Every single person at the Y was new once, and this community is built on lifting each other up.

If you’re ready to step in with confidence, here are some helpful tips to make the Y feel like home from the start.

 

1. Start with Less Crowded Times

Worried about walking into a crowded gym? You’re not alone! The good news is that the Y has plenty of quieter times where you can get comfortable at your own pace. Mid-morning or early afternoon is often when things slow down, making it easier to learn the layout and try equipment without any pressure. 2. Join a Group Exercise Class

One of the easiest ways to feel at home at the Y is by joining a group class! Whether it’s cycling, strength training, or a calming yoga session, you’ll be surrounded by people who encourage and inspire you. And since we have a wide slection of classes for all fitness levels, you’ll fit right in—no matter where you’re starting from.

3. Celebrate Small Wins

Progress isn’t always measured in big leaps—it’s in the little things, too! Every time you lace up your sneakers, complete a workout, or try something new, you’re moving forward. Take a moment to appreciate how far you’ve come—because every win, no matter how small, is worth celebrating!

4. Focus on Your Workout

At the Y, we’re all in this together, but that doesn’t mean anyone is critiquing your every move. Most people are too busy focusing on their own goals! So take a deep breath, focus on yourself, and enjoy your workout.

5. Don't Be Afraid to Ask for Help

You’re not expected to know everything on day one! If you need guidance, just ask—our staff is always happy to help. And for extra support, sign up for a Fitness Orientation to set yourself up for success.
